javascript - 获取此 DIV 的父 ID

标签 javascript jquery

当在 jquery/javascript 中的“.buttonleft0”中单击按钮时,我希望从此布局中找到父 div id(即“Bakerloo”)。

<div id='Bakerloo' class='box'>bakerloo<p></p><span class='buttons'>
<span class='buttonleft0'><button onClick='up()'><span class='icon icon10'></span>
</button>
</span><span class='buttonleft'></span><span class='buttonright'></span></span>
<div class='comingup'></div>
<div class='more'></div></div>

我已经尝试过:

$(this).parent('id');

但这只是返回“未定义”。

最佳答案

$(this).closest('div').attr('id')

我想这就是你想要的

关于javascript - 获取此 DIV 的父 ID,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15312567/

相关文章:

jquery - 无法在 Jquery 中选择元素

javascript - 通过鼠标单击 HTML 选择单个元素

javascript - Angular 保护功能

javascript - 无需插件即可以特定格式获取 jquery 中的时间戳

javascript - 如何让滚动后出现滚动到顶部按钮

jquery - 有没有jquery插件可以创建马赛克背景?

javascript - 使用 JS 触发 Bootstrap 下拉菜单

javascript - 设置仅值属性而不是键值

javascript - 解释var {A : a} = {A: 1}

javascript - 将 mixin 与 ko.compated 添加到 knockout View 模型